Unix环境H5高并发服务器优化方案
发布时间:2026-02-10 09:58:32 所属栏目:Unix 来源:DaWei
导读: 在Unix环境下构建高并发的H5(HTML5)服务器,需要从系统配置、网络架构和应用层优化等多个方面入手。操作系统本身的性能调优是基础,包括调整内核参数如文件描述符数量、网络协议栈设置以及进程调度策略。 网
|
在Unix环境下构建高并发的H5(HTML5)服务器,需要从系统配置、网络架构和应用层优化等多个方面入手。操作系统本身的性能调优是基础,包括调整内核参数如文件描述符数量、网络协议栈设置以及进程调度策略。 网络层面的优化同样关键。使用高效的网络协议如TCP/IP,并结合非阻塞I/O模型或事件驱动框架(如epoll或kqueue)可以显著提升服务器处理并发请求的能力。合理配置负载均衡器,将请求分发到多个后端实例,能够有效避免单点过载。 在应用层,采用异步处理机制和多线程/多进程模型有助于提高响应速度。同时,引入缓存机制,例如Redis或Memcached,减少对数据库的直接访问,能大幅降低延迟并提升吞吐量。对于静态资源,使用CDN加速可进一步优化用户体验。 代码层面的优化也不容忽视。避免阻塞操作,合理管理连接池,减少不必要的内存分配和垃圾回收,都是提升性能的重要手段。定期进行压力测试和性能分析,可以帮助发现瓶颈并及时调整。
AI分析图,仅供参考 监控和日志系统是保障高并发服务器稳定运行的重要工具。通过实时监控CPU、内存、网络等指标,可以快速定位问题。同时,完善的日志记录为后续的故障排查和性能调优提供数据支持。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

